About this property
The Manse
Adults-only guesthouse in Daylesford with hot tub
A spa tub and free WiFi in public areas are available at this smoke-free guesthouse. All 5 rooms provide in-room free WiFi, fridges and coffee makers.
The Manse offers 5 accommodations. This Daylesford guest house prov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Fridges and coffee/tea makers are provided. Rooms have partially open bathrooms. Bathrooms include a shower. Housekeeping is provided on request.
Recreational amenities at the guest house include a spa tub.
